You can take out life insurance at many stages in your life, and many people will do that when they are younger. But the fact is, many of us find that our 40s is a pivotal decade when we want to protect our loved ones with life insurance.
Getting married, buying a home, starting or growing a family, building a business…these are all things thousands of us do in our forties. Life insurance often goes hand-in-hand with these milestones. Also, many of us may take these steps earlier in life, but may not get around to putting the right protection in place.
So what cover might you need in your forties? Term life insurance covers you for a set number of years (like the length of your mortgage or while you’re raising a family), while whole life insurance guarantees a payout no matter when you pass away. You can also add extras like critical illness cover for additional reassurance.
